Why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ion Matter for Your Business with Marie Roker-Jones

Marie Roker-Jones joins Angie on the podcast to talk about why diversity, equity, and inclusion (DEI) matter for businesses. Marie shares some tips on how to create a DEI culture within your own business.

Marie also talks about the hustle culture, the importance of self-care, and how to overcome imposter syndrome.

Big Ideas Inside This Episode 

  • Social impact is about how you contribute to making where you live a more sustainable environment and making the world a better place. 
  • To achieve greatness and feel a deep sense of purpose it’s important to look outside your own personal interests. 
  • Affinity bias hurts your ability as a business to serve your customers, clients, vendors, and suppliers. 
  • How to think about your customers through the lens of intersectionality to avoid missing out on reaching a group of your ideal customers. 
  • In this hustle culture, the more you keep pushing and giving out and not replenishing yourself, the less productive and effective you are. 
  • You can be so much more productive if you stop for a minute and say, “what do I need in this moment to feel good mentally, emotionally, and physically.” 
  • Overcome imposter syndrome by remembering that you’re not an imposter, you’re an outlier.

About Marie Roker-Jones: 

Marie Roker-Jones is the co-Ceo of Essteem. Essteem organizes actionable programs, Equalithons (hackathons for equality), that help tech companies develop their sustainability strategies and create more socially, environmentally, and economically responsible workplace cultures that integrate CSR into their DEI hiring and retention goals.

Marie is a social impact startup founder with over ten years of experience in leading gender and racial diversity strategies. Marie also has workforce and career development experience creating workforce reentry programs for underrepresented communities through coalition building, employment readiness, networking opportunities, and community outreach.
